Ransomware forensics investigation is aimed at determining and describing the ransomware attack's progress throughout the network from start to finish. This history of how a ransomware assault progressed within the network helps you to evaluate the damage and highlights vulnerabilities in security policies or work habits that should be rectified to avoid future breaches. Forensics is commonly assigned a high priority by the cyber insurance provider and is typically required by state and industry regulations. Because forensic analysis can be time consuming, it is critical that other key recovery processes like operational resumption are performed in parallel. Progent maintains a large roster of information technology and cybersecurity experts with the knowledge and experience needed to carry out the work of containment, business continuity, and data restoration without interfering with forensic analysis.

Ransomware forensics analysis is time consuming and calls for close interaction with the groups focused on data cleanup and, if needed, payment talks with the ransomware hacker. Ransomware forensics typically require the examination of all logs, registry, Group Policy Object, AD, DNS servers, routers, firewalls, schedulers, and basic Windows systems to check for changes.

Services associated with forensics analysis include:

  • Isolate but avoid shutting down all potentially affected devices from the network. This can require closing all Remote Desktop Protocol (RDP) ports and Internet facing NAS storage, changing admin credentials and user PWs, and setting up 2FA to guard your backups.
  • Create forensically sound images of all suspect devices so the file restoration group can proceed
  • Preserve firewall, virtual private network, and additional critical logs as soon as possible
  • Establish the version of ransomware used in the assault
  • Survey each computer and data store on the system including cloud storage for signs of compromise
  • Inventory all compromised devices
  • Determine the type of ransomware used in the attack
  • Review log activity and sessions to establish the time frame of the attack and to identify any possible sideways migration from the originally compromised machine
  • Identify the security gaps used to perpetrate the ransomware attack
  • Search for the creation of executables surrounding the first encrypted files or system compromise
  • Parse Outlook PST files
  • Examine attachments
  • Separate any URLs from messages and check to see whether they are malicious
  • Provide extensive attack documentation to meet your insurance carrier and compliance mandates
  • Document recommended improvements to close cybersecurity gaps and improve workflows that lower the exposure to a future ransomware exploit
